HUBER Solutions for Sludge Drying

During thermal sludge drying almost all water is evaporated, including surface, capillary and cell water. Supply of heat is needed, preferably from combined power and heat generation systems. A great portion of the drying heat is recovered from the exhaust and re-circulated. Solids contents in the dried product of 90% DS and above can be achieved.

Biosolids/Sludge Dryer

The K-S Paddle Sludge Dryer is indirectly heated using steam or circulated thermal fluid (hot oil). High-energy efficiencies and low off-gas volumes are characteristics of a K-S Drying System. The K-S Paddle Sludge Dryer is an indirect heat transfer device that utilizes mechanical agitation to enhance contact with the product being dried.

Thin Film Sludge Dryer

The sludge is pumped into the dryer where the rotating blades on the rotor convey and evenly spread the sludge into a thin film (1-3mm) against the outer heating surface. Heating fluid (steam, water, or thermal oil) flows on the outside of the heating surface and heat is indirectly transferred to the sludge film.

Sludge Drying | HUBER Technology

The disc dryer is a contact dryer designed for the partial drying of dewatered sewage sludge to 40 – 45% DR and is heated with saturated steam up to max. 10 bar(a). HUBER disc dryers are often used in combination with fluidized bed incinerators for medium to large and very large volumes of sewage sludge.
